Vacancy Detail

This Level 2 apprenticeship will help you learn how to carry out vehicle safety inspections and routine maintenance, using vehicle-specific data to the necessary legal requirements. You will learn the fundamentals of specific vehicle systems including steering and suspension, braking systems, battery and charging systems, exhaust systems, and air-conditioning systems. This program focuses on developing communications skills to form effective working relationships with colleagues and building the confidence needed to make recommendations to customers based on the results of inspections that are accurate and fully costed, ethical, and in the best interests of the customer.
You will receive first-class training in all the latest servicing, maintenance, and diagnostic techniques.

Day to day tasks will vary but include:
• Servicing – carrying out vehicle/tire checks
• MOT’s – assisting to identify parts with wear and tear
• Maintenance – replacing/repairing engine parts
• Diagnostics – using the latest diagnostic equipment
• Maintaining repair and service records
